Output 68a0add0abbc2e8817f9ffab7a33db04e5fb4efbfc96d000dc4a74dd34efea49:6

value
31862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a5cf45520adc5a4d5d37080f729dca9bec357ca OP_EQUAL
address
3Cr1iXuWZESFsKuwaKmQZXxKDNLv689jpx
transaction
68a0add0abbc2e8817f9ffab7a33db04e5fb4efbfc96d000dc4a74dd34efea49
confirmations
349214
spent
true